The story centers on Bryan Mills (Liam Neeson), a retired CIA operative who has left a life of violence behind to be closer to his estranged daughter, Kim (Maggie Grace). Kim lives with her mother, Lenore (Famke Janssen), and her wealthy stepfather.

The story follows Bryan Mills, a retired CIA operative with a "very particular set of skills." When his estranged daughter is kidnapped by human traffickers while on vacation in Paris, Bryan has 96 hours to find her before she disappears forever.
